PureCycle CEO surrenders shares for tax withholding
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
PureCycle Technologies, Inc. Chief Executive Officer Dustin Olson reported a tax-withholding disposition of 11,149 shares of common stock on 2026-08-05 at $6.87 per share, surrendered to cover tax liability from a vesting equity grant under the company's 2021 Equity and Incentive Compensation Plan. After this, he directly holds 1,309,960 shares.

FAQ
What transaction did PureCycle (PCT) CEO Dustin Olson report on this Form 4?
Dustin Olson reported surrendering 11,149 shares of PureCycle common stock on 2026-08-05 at $6.87 per share to cover tax liabilities from a vesting equity grant. These shares were delivered for taxes rather than sold in the open market.
Does this PureCycle (PCT) Form 4 show any open-market buying or selling by the CEO?
No open-market purchases or sales are reported. The Form 4 records only a tax-withholding disposition of 11,149 shares, surrendered to satisfy tax liability on a vesting equity grant, with no separate buy or sell transactions disclosed.
Was the reported PureCycle (PCT) transaction under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an?
The transaction was not reported as under a Rule 10b5-1 plan. The document-level checkbox indicating trades p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1 arrangement was not selected for this tax-withholding share surrender.
